Die Hantzschsche Pyrrolsynthese (Hantzsch’sche Pyrrolsynthese), auch bekannt als die Hantzsch-Pyrrolsynthese, ist eine Namensreaktion der organischen Chemie. Sie wurde nach dem deutschen Chemiker Arthur Hantzsch (1857–1935) benannt, der sie im Jahre 1890 veröffentlichte. Sie dient zur Synthese von Pyrrol und dessen Derivaten.
